刻下岁月

逝者如斯夫,不舍昼夜…
Home  /  未分类  /  Cloudera Manager CHD 切换内置数据库PostgreSQL 到 Mysql

Cloudera Manager CHD 切换内置数据库PostgreSQL 到 Mysql

五月 29, 2018 未分类 Leave a Comment

安装mysql:

yum install mysql mysql-server   #询问是否要安装,输入Y即可自动安装,直到安装完成  
/etc/init.d/mysqld start   #启动MySQL  
chkconfig mysqld on   #设为开机启动  

在集群设置的数据库设置时会报如下错误

解决办法下载mysql的驱动包

wget https://dev.mysql.com/get/Downloads/Connector-J/mysql-connector-java-5.1.46.tar.gz

解压后移动驱动到 /usr/share/java/下 没有java文件夹的话自行创建

tar -zxvf mysql-connector-java-5.1.46.tar.gz
mv mysql-connector-java-5.1.46.jar  /usr/share/java/mysql-connector-java.jar #注意改名

再点击测试连接 

报了新的错误 这个是因为新装的数据库里面没有这些库名和用户导致的,创建指定用户并授权

连接数据库

 mysql -uroot -p

添加数据库用户并授权

create user 'oozie'@'%' identified by 'VegNOJxlKZ';
create database oozie;
grant all on oozie.* to 'oozie'@'%' identified by 'VegNOJxlKZ';
flush privileges

注意:MySQL中默认存在一个用户名为空的账户,只要在本地,可以不用输入账号密码即可登录到MySQL中

再次点击测试连接则通过

2506total visits,132visits today

nginx 启动失败 (nginx: [emerg] socket() [::]:80 failed)
原文地址:http://blog.lunhui.ren/archives/485
原创文章,转载请注明出处!

Leave a Reply

取消回复

近期文章

  • Cloudera Manager CHD 切换内置数据库PostgreSQL 到 Mysql
  • nginx 启动失败 (nginx: [emerg] socket() [::]:80 failed)
  • Centos6离线安装Cloudera Manager 5.14.3 CDH5.14.0
  • shell脚本大量清除数据库数据 & 清理数据库空间碎片
  • java 分析cpu飙升 内存泄露工具
  • curl 远程 请求
  • tcpdump抓取 指定 ip 端口 的网络数据
  • mysql 查询数据库每一个表的大小

分类目录

  • DB9
  • English1
  • git1
  • Java16
  • Js4
  • Linux18
  • PHP5
  • Tools4
  • window2
  • 大数据1
  • 未分类3
  • 笑一笑1